Is there a national standard for nondestructive testing of important wire ropes?

GB89 18-2006 Important purpose steel wire rope, which is the national standard of steel wire rope, including strength, diameter tolerance and breaking force. Non-destructive testing is about wire rope wear and broken wires. It is not clear whether there is a national standard for this kind of detection and error, and no similar standard has been seen.

Wire ropes commonly used in lifting equipment include phosphating coated wire ropes, galvanized wire ropes, stainless steel wire ropes or plastic coated wire ropes. The manganese phosphating coated steel wire rope produced by patented technology has the longest service life. Manganese phosphating film can greatly improve the wear resistance and corrosion resistance of wire rope surface. The fatigue life of phosphating coated steel wire rope is 3-4 times that of smooth steel wire rope. With the research of wear-resistant phosphating solution, there is still the possibility of further improvement. According to the current market price of phosphating coated wire rope, the daily average cost of phosphating coated wire rope is only about 30% of that of smooth wire rope.
